0

我的 Web 应用程序有时会返回一个空响应。细节:

  • 这是一个经过良好测试的 Web 应用程序,所以我确信这是环境级别的问题,而不是代码级别的问题。似乎应用程序中的任何脚本都可以产生这个结果,并且没有明显的规则。同一个请求可以返回一次数据,一秒钟后返回一个空响应。

  • 日志:Apache 访问日志显示:

    127.0.0.1 - - [21/Apr/2013:14:40:59 +0300] "GET /path/to/app.php?modeofform=update HTTP/1.1" 200 - 我从中了解到 apache 知道它没有返回数据

Apache 错误日志显示没有问题,与 php 错误日志相同

  • 当我使用调试器运行请求时,我可以看到代码正确执行,并执行 echo 语句(但正如我所说,浏览器甚至 apache 都没有任何内容)

  • 2 个不同浏览器的结果相同,所以不是浏览器故障

  • 软件:Php 5.3、apache 2.2.22、PhpStorm 6.01 IDE、Xdebug、Windows7

  • 当我在新计算机上重新安装环境时问题开始了+更改了php5.2 => php5.3,zenddebuger => xdebug,旧版本的apache => apache 2.2.22(一般升级)

4

0 回答 0